A TEENAGER has died from his injuries after sand collapsed on him and his sister at a New Jersey beach.

Levi Caverley, 18, and his 17-year-old sister were visiting the beach in Toms River with their family on Tuesday.

The family had been visiting from Maine.

The siblings had used frisbees to dig a ten-foot hole in the sand before it collapsed on both of them, said Mayor Mo Hill.

Emergency crews at the scene were able to rescue the girl, but Levi Caverley died during the collapse.

Police and EMS are still working to recover his body.
